Akasa Air, India’s newest airline, has added Varanasi as its 14th destination. It will begin non-stop daily flights from Bengaluru to Varanasi on February 18th, 2023 and increase frequency starting March 1st, 2023.
The airline will also offer daily flights from Bengaluru to Goa via Varanasi, providing a seamless connection between the two popular tourist destinations.
Varanasi is Akasa Air’s second destination in Uttar Pradesh after launching flights from Lucknow to Mumbai and Bengaluru in December 2022.
The airline established a solid national presence in just six months by connecting metros to tier 2 and 3 cities. The airline plans to add a new aircraft to its fleet every 15 days.

Akasa Air Varanasi Flight Schedule
Flight No. | From | Dep. Time | To | Arr. Time | Type | Start Date |
QP 1421 | Bengaluru | 12:30 | Varanasi | 15:00 | Non-Stop | Feb 18 |
QP 1422 | Varanasi | 15:40 | Bengaluru | 18:05 | Non-Stop | Feb 18 |
QP 1421 | Bengaluru | 5:35 | Varanasi | 8:15 | Non-Stop | Mar 01 |
QP 1422 | Varanasi | 9:05 | Bengaluru | 11:40 | Through | Mar 01 |
QP 1422 | Bengaluru | 12:30 | Goa | 13:35 | – | Mar 01 |
QP 1423 | Goa | 14:15 | Bengaluru | 15:25 | Through | Mar 01 |
QP 1423 | Bengaluru | 16:10 | Varanasi | 18:40 | – | Mar 01 |
QP 1424 | Varanasi | 19:20 | Bengaluru | 21:45 | Non-Stop | Mar 01 |

Since its launch in August 2022, Akasa Air has carried over 1 million revenue passengers and crossed the milestone of operating over 575 weekly flights with an announced network of 21 unique routes connecting 14 cities, namely Ahmedabad, Bengaluru, Kochi, Chennai, Mumbai, Delhi, Guwahati, Agartala, Pune, Visakhapatnam, Lucknow, Goa, Hyderabad, and Varanasi.
